We visited on a Saturday (early afternoon) and had a great time with our 15 and 11 year old kids. The lunch scene is very tame. We played retro video games and Uno while waiting for our food, and we all took part in some jumbo-sized Jenga and cornhole after lunch. We did call ahead to ask about the kids and were told they are welcome before 8 PM.
